Top Law News HC strikes down municipal notification July 26, 2014 by Legal India Admin | Leave a Comment In a significant order, the Calcutta High Court today struck down the authority of the municipal bodies in West Bengal to regularise unauthorised constructions against acceptance of retention fee. Top Law News Bengal agreeable to court’s proposal on Singur compensation September 16, 2011 by Legal India Admin | Leave a Comment The West Bengal government Thursday reacted positively to the Calcutta High Court’s proposal of determining the guidelines for compensation to be given to automobile giant Tata Motors in the Singur land case. However, the company opposed the court’s move saying it did not have any such locus standi.
